Text

The Competitive Livestock Markets Cash Fund is created. The fund shall be administered by the department. The fund shall consist of investigative and enforcement expense assessments against violators of the Competitive Livestock Markets Act and fees paid by a packer pursuant to section 54-2627 . The money in the fund shall be used to defray the investigative, enforcement, and reporting expenses of the department in administering the act. Any money in the fund available for investment shall be invested by the state investment officer pursuant to the Nebraska Capital Expansion Act and the Nebraska State Funds Investment Act.

Legislative History

Source: Laws 1999, LB 835, § 28. Cross References: Nebraska Capital Expansion Act, see section 72-1269. Nebraska State Funds Investment Act, see section 72-1260.
